What is the National Grid Project Information Form?
The National Grid Project Information Form serves as a comprehensive tool for collecting vital information and specifications related to energy efficiency projects in New York. By utilizing this form, participants can ensure that they are meeting the requirements for implementing energy-efficient solutions. This is particularly relevant for those involved in energy efficiency improvement projects, as the form lays the groundwork for obtaining necessary incentives and approvals.

What are the eligibility requirements for using the National Grid Project Information Form?
Eligibility for using the National Grid Project Information Form typically includes being a customer in New York with a project focused on energy efficiency improvements, such as lighting systems.
